The invention relates to the technical field of safety accessories of tower cranes, and discloses a tower crane lifting hook rope breakage anti-falling device and a using method thereof.The tower crane lifting hook rope breakage anti-falling device comprises a tower crane lifting arm, a variable-amplitude trolley is arranged at the bottom of the tower crane lifting arm, a lifting hook assembly is arranged at the bottom of the variable-amplitude trolley, and a top ring is arranged at the top of the lifting hook assembly; an anti-falling buffering mechanism is arranged at the bottom of the variable-amplitude trolley and comprises a fixing plate, the top of the fixing plate is fixedly connected with the bottom of the variable-amplitude trolley, an anti-falling left box plate is fixedly installed on the left side of the bottom of the fixing plate, and the anti-falling left box plate is in an L shape. A first compression spring and a second compression spring on the first buffering mechanism can provide elastic buffering for the first sliding sleeve and the second sliding sleeve to move towards the two sides, and meanwhile, a tension spring can provide tension buffering for the first sliding sleeve and the second sliding sleeve to move towards the two sides, so that the buffering capacity of the whole device is greatly improved; and serious safety accidents caused by rope breakage of the tower crane lifting hook are avoided.
